It’s commonly used to power larger appliances in your home, like your oven, your clothes dryer, or your air conditioner. So, it’s kind of important!
Essentially, “240V” refers to the voltage, which is the electrical pressure pushing the current through the wires. Higher voltage can deliver more power, which is why it’s used for those beefier appliances. “Single phase” refers to the type of alternating current (AC) electrical power distribution. It means the power is delivered using a single alternating voltage. No need to panic about understanding AC vs. DC for now, just know it’s the way most residential power is delivered.
Compared to the standard 120V outlets you use for lamps and phone chargers, 240V provides twice the “oomph.” This allows these appliances to heat up faster, run more efficiently, or generally do their job better. You might be wondering if you have 240V in your home. Well, if you have an electric oven, dryer, or a central air conditioning unit, chances are you do. These appliances usually require a dedicated 240V circuit. These circuits typically have a different type of outlet than your regular 120V outlets.
